Yet more Added To Slam Dunk Festival 2017

Showing no signs of slowing down, Slam Dunk Festival 2017 have unveiled that Neck Deep, Citizen, Turnover, Set It Off, Memphis May Fire, I Prevail, Ice Nine Kills and Oceans Ate Alaska will join headliners Enter Shikari for the biggest pop-punk festival of the year.
 
Welsh pop-punk sensations Neck Deep have enjoyed a mammoth 18 months, taking over festival main stages and leading a generation with their infectious singalong hooks on both sides of the Atlantic. With debut album 'Wishful Thinking’ already landing as one of the genre’s definitive releases of the past few years, their return to Slam Dunk is set to be a true coronation of a band primed to continue their emphatic journey.
 
Coming from the ever evolving Run For Cover Records stable, labelmates Citizen and Turnover will be making their first appearances at Slam Dunk Festival.

Leading with anthemic singalongs and unrelenting beatdowns alike, both Set it Off and Memphis May Fire will be making their return to Slam Dunk Festival.
 
Set It Off, the upbeat Floridian mob who are renowned for their exhilarating live show will be bringing their extensive feelgood back catalogue to the festival with acclaimed singles such as ‘Forever Stuck In Our Youth’ and ‘Ancient History’. Metal powerhouse Memphis May Fire are also set to bring a high-octane performance to Slam Dunk Festival 2017 as they return to the stage with blistering new album ‘This Light I Hold’.
 
Fearless Records will be delivering an incredible metalcore invasion as the visceral I Prevail, melodic thrillers Ice Nine Kills and tech-heavy Oceans Ate Alaska are all set to storm Birmingham, Leeds and Hatfield this May.
 
Kicking off in Birmingham on Saturday 27th May, the festival will travel to Leeds on Sunday 28th May before finishing up in Hatfield on Monday 29th May, once again ensuring the Slam Dunk Festival Bank Holiday Weekend is the only place to be to catch the finest in alternative music.
 
FULL LINE-UP TO DATE
Enter Shikari, Neck Deep, Beartooth, Tonight Alive, Citizen, Turnover, Set It Off,  Against Me! The Bronx, Goldfinger, Mad Caddies, Memphis May Fire, The Movielife, Don Broco, Bowling For Soup, Less Than Jake, Reel Big Fish, Cute Is What We Aim For, We The Kings, I Prevail, Ice Nine Kills, Oceans Ate Alaska, Trophy Eyes, Like Pacific.
